New York University seeks an Executive Director for Schools & Institutes to provide leadership and supervision for the experienced fundraising teams in four of NYU's Schools & Institutes, including: the Gallatin School of Individualized Study; The Institute of Fine Arts; the Division of Libraries; and the School of Professional Studies. This senior position will report directly to the Associate Vice President for Schools & Institutes. The candidate will be responsible for leading the School teams to a minimum of $30M raised annually and achieving a personal fundraising goal of $3M. The Executive Director will work closely with the AVP of Schools and Institutes to set annual and individual fundraising goals in partnership with academic Deans and University Development and Alumni Relations (UDAR) leadership in support of strongly articulated and well-crafted funding priorities.
The Executive Director will contribute to a collaborative fundraising environment and participate in strategy sessions across Schools and Institutes in support of interest-based, donor-centric prospect assignments. The Executive Director will have a broad base of progressive fundraising experiences, preferably in higher education, in order to provide the leadership, strategy, and insights required to support skillful fundraisers. The candidate will possess the discipline of frontline fundraising in order to manage a select portfolio of high-capacity prospects and donors with a documented track record of closing 7-figure gifts. In support of these goals, the candidate will have the ability to plan, forecast, and communicate annual plans and manage budgetary resources accordingly.
